Senior Design Engineer role based in Lancaster. Working for a well established industrial manufacturing company.

Client Details

Our client is a well established, SME manufacturing company based in Lancaster.

Description

Main Purpose of the Role

Lead and develop the technical team in the design and development of all products. Support the commercial function of the business with technical input for both new & existing customer or technical enquiries. Manage and develop a team of designers and draughtsmen. Responsible for all new & existing product design activity, generating quotes, drawings/models & structural assessments (FEA) utilising Solidworks. Main point of contact for design queries for clients or internal team members. Lead the technical design process for both new and existing products which require modification including preparation of CAD drawings on Solidworks. Identify & deliver cost savings through value engineering without compromising the existing integrity or quality of the product. Management of the company's technical database, ensuring that all products have the appropriate technical drawings and that these are up to date and accurate. Utilise Solidworks Simulation (FEA) to ensure that products maintain structural integrity & quality. Research new technologies/ideas to enable proactive innovation and maintain market leadership. Create standard ranges of all product streams in assembly and sub-assembly format for quoting and further customisation. Identify appropriate suppliers for new materials or components that meet quality and price requirements. Liaise with operational teams to ensure product is designed for manufacture in line with customer expectations. Work with the operational team to ensure appropriate testing processes are followed and certified where required. Provide advice, guidance, and assist problem-solving to manufacturing and assembly departments as required. Ensure that materials from existing suppliers are delivered to specification. Profile

People Manager or supervisory experience with a proven track record in managing or supervising a small design engineering team. Fully versed and experienced in the use of Solidworks 3D CAD package or similar design software. Understanding of manufacturing technologies, processes and installation. A solid manufacturing background in a mechanical design engineering role. Able to effectively communicate technical details with internal and external stakeholders. Able to effectively communicate with customers and suppliers. An innovative thinker who can bring solutions to the table. Ability to work independently, self-motivated, with good team working skills. Highly organised, with strong attention to detail and the ability to multitask and prioritise. High standard computer skills, including proficiency in Microsoft Office packages (Excel, Outlook, Word). Job Offer

£50,000 to £55,000 plus package.
